• Free version works great but is very limited. You can’t control the pages on which the icons appear unless you buy the Pro version. Not many people want the PDF print icons on their home page, nor on their picture galleries.

    When I purchased the pro version, the “add-on” plugin would NOT install. I kept getting error messages about my server didn’t support zip files. I tried manually installing the plug-in upgrade, and it just failed with no error message. I also deactivated the free version and tried to install the pro version (this was recommended in their documentation help). That didn’t work either. Who needs the aggravation, switch to a different plugin.

    There are other FREE plugins which provide a superior experience, and install without a hitch.

    1) Yes, if your hosting doesn’t support zip files, you can see the message about an inability to install the plugin automatically. In such case it is necessary to install the plugin manually in accordance to our instruction. Usually there are no problems with manually installing, and even if there are, we’re trying to help solve them.

    2) The functionality presented in the free plugin version is quite sufficient for the most part of our users. If somebody needs more, he/she can purchase the Pro version where additional options are available. The basic principle that we follow when creating our plugins is ease of use of our products, and if we add all functionality which all our users would like to have – this will lead to the fact that our products no longer convenient to use due to the large number of settings. However, you can make an offer on the plugin development and refinement. We will consider it, and if we deem it necessary, we will make the changes to the plugin in future updates.
